Fear of God and New Era to launch MLB All-Star cap collection

Published
Jul 3, 2017

Fear of God unveiled on Thursday a special capsule collection with New Era made to benefit the Jackie Robison Foundation and the MLB Playball Initiative.


The Fear of God x MLB All-Star Collection - MLB

 
Designer Jerry Lorenzo has very deep ties with Major League Baseball that goes beyond the collection. His father, Jerry Manuel, was a major league baseball player and minor league coach, a manager of the Chicago White Sox and New York Mets, a coach for the Montreal Expos and Mets and became World Series champion as coach of the Florida Marlins in 1997. Lorenzo and his family often moved around to be with Jerry, whether that was in West Palm Beach, Chicago or Montreal.
 
The Fear of God x MLB All-Star Collection honors not only Lorenzo’s father, but also MLB greats Ken Griffey Jr., Darryl Strawberry, and Dave Winfield, among others. Each cap in the collection features each player’s All-Star jersey number on the back, as well as a logo from the year each player was in the All-Star game.

In addition, Fear of God and New Era will launch a special 1997 Collection to celebrate the 20th anniversary of the Florida Marlins’ championship season.
 
The limited edition capsule collection will retail for $200.
